检查和编辑对象的私有/受保护属性
在 MATLAB 2011b 中,我有一些类具有许多私有或受保护的类属性。这是设计使然,因为我不希望这些除了我的类自己的 getter/setter 之外的任何东西都可…
从长远来看,传递整个对象还是传递一系列参数更易于维护?
我通过在页面的构造函数中包含对对象的引用作为参数来将数据传递到 C# 中的页面。我仅使用页面中对象的一部分成员。对此类页面的调用如下所示: new P…
为什么子类调用它的父类函数以及它们自己的函数?
我开始掌握 Perl/Moose 继承的窍门,但我开始遇到一些困难。 例如,继承对象的构建顺序似乎是有意义的,但继承似乎并不像我期望的那样工作—— 如果我…
共享通用对象 - 警告“已定义但未使用”
我有许多 C++ 类,其中很多(不是全部)共享两个“静态大小变量”,例如 share.h /*Other variables in this header used by all classes*/ static si…
AS3:位于外部 swf 中的外部类中的访问函数
我正在尝试访问已加载的 swf 中具有外部类的函数。 我想避免必须将该函数放在外部 swf 中的“Main”Doc 类上 而是直接从类访问该函数 这是我到目前为…
使数据成员随处可访问,但只读
我刚刚开始自己的 Windows API 包装器,在重写结构以包含 C++ 功能时遇到了一个不熟悉的主题。 我正在把这个: typedef struct _RECT { LONG left…
抽象类构造函数中的抽象方法:设计缺陷?
我有一个抽象类Entity。每个扩展 Entity 的类都需要一些默认设置和一些可自定义的设置: public abstract class Entity { protected Entity() { // ..…